I have 5 games worth of audio for DXC Dracula, so after many fails I get ok Dracula cloning. but Death I don't have that much audio, so probably can't replace any of his lines. kinda sad really. because in the Japanese Death really shows a lot of respect towards Alucard. we don't really see this in the psx or psp dubs. he literally asks Alucard to reconsider his decision to attack them, and he will give him time to think it over. and even in the last fight with him, you can see how much he hates to fight Alucard but will take his soul for his master. here is a fan Translation I copied.


Death: Oh, if it isn't Lord Alucard...
What could possibly have brought you here?
Alucard: That, you already know...
Now stand aside.
Death: I presume you are still befiending humans, yes?
I dare not ask you to rejoin us...
But do not raise your arms against us, at the very least.
Alucard: I cannot meet that request.
Death: Then I am left with no choice..
I shall withdraw from here.
Just use this opportunity to reconsider things...

then much later

Death: So, you have finally come this far...
I say this only once more. For your father's sake, lower your weapons.
Alucard: Ever since I arrived, I've had no such plans.
Death: I am truly sorry to hear that.
For the sake of my master, I will clam your soul!

anyway glad you enjoyed it, when I get time I plan to do more. maybe offer a download for the voice files. and let people rebuild the ISO themselves.  with UMDGen you just need to copy the full ISO folders to your hard drive then close UMDGen. then replace the AT3 voice files in the right folder. and open UMDGen and under the file tab build ISO. and you have patched the game basically.
